揭秘rel canonical的含义与应用:提升网站SEO的关键
揭秘rel canonical的含义与应用:提升网站SEO的关键
在网站优化和搜索引擎优化(SEO)领域,rel canonical是一个非常重要的概念。今天我们将深入探讨rel canonical的含义、其工作原理以及在实际应用中的重要性。
rel canonical的全称是“rel=canonical”,它是HTML中的一个属性,用于指定一个网页的“规范”版本。当一个网站上有多个URL指向相同或非常相似的内容时,搜索引擎可能会认为这些页面是重复内容,从而影响网站的SEO效果。rel canonical的作用就是告诉搜索引擎哪个URL是这些页面中最主要、最规范的版本。
rel canonical的含义
rel canonical的含义在于它提供了一种方法来处理网站上的重复内容问题。通过在HTML头部添加<link rel="canonical" href="URL">
标签,网站管理员可以明确指出哪个URL是该内容的首选版本。例如,如果你的网站上有两个页面,一个是example.com/page
和另一个是example.com/page?utm_source=newsletter
,你可以使用rel canonical来告诉搜索引擎这两个页面实际上是同一个内容的不同版本,而example.com/page
是首选。
rel canonical的工作原理
当搜索引擎爬虫访问一个页面时,它会检查页面中的rel canonical标签。如果发现该标签,它会将该页面的权重传递给规范URL,从而避免重复内容的惩罚。同时,搜索引擎会将索引和排名信号集中到规范URL上,确保搜索结果中显示的是最佳版本。
rel canonical的应用场景
-
参数化URL:许多网站使用参数来跟踪用户行为或进行A/B测试,这些参数会生成大量的URL变体。使用rel canonical可以确保这些变体不会被视为重复内容。
-
移动和桌面版本:对于有独立移动网站的企业,可以使用rel canonical来链接移动页面到桌面版本,确保搜索引擎知道哪个版本是主要的。
-
内容聚合:如果你的网站聚合了来自不同来源的内容,使用rel canonical可以避免内容重复问题。
-
内容迁移:在网站重构或迁移过程中,rel canonical可以帮助旧URL的权重转移到新URL上。
rel canonical的注意事项
- 正确使用:确保rel canonical指向的是正确的URL,避免指向错误或不存在的页面。
- 一致性:所有重复内容页面都应该指向同一个规范URL。
- 避免循环:不要让rel canonical形成循环引用,否则会导致搜索引擎无法确定规范页面。
- 与其他SEO技术结合:rel canonical应该与其他SEO技术如301重定向、robots.txt等结合使用,以达到最佳效果。
结论
rel canonical是网站SEO优化中的一个重要工具,它不仅帮助解决了重复内容的问题,还能有效地提升网站的搜索引擎排名。通过正确使用rel canonical,网站管理员可以确保搜索引擎正确理解和索引网站内容,从而提高用户体验和网站的整体表现。无论你是网站开发者、SEO专家还是内容创作者,了解和应用rel canonical都是提升网站质量的关键一步。希望本文能为你提供有价值的信息,帮助你在网站优化之路上更进一步。